Our pricing structure is transparent. For standard events (birthdays, family gatherings, casual celebrations), you're looking at around $70 per person with a typical minimum of 10 guests. That covers everything: the chef's time and expertise, all proteins (filet mignon, chicken, shrimp, or a combination), fried rice, vegetables, our signature sauces, professional flat-top grills, propane, serving equipment, and the full teppanyaki show. Corporate events or weddings with additional service requirements may run higher, but we'll tell you that upfront.

What drives cost variations? Guest count is the biggest factor—larger groups benefit from economies of scale. A 50-person corporate event has a lower per-person cost than a 12-person party. Location within LA County matters too; we serve everywhere from Downtown to the beaches, but events requiring extended travel times to remote areas may include a travel fee. Menu customization is the third variable—if you want all filet mignon instead of mixed proteins, or you're adding lobster tail birthday, that affects pricing.

Straight Answers to Real Questions

How much does hibachi catering really cost in Los Angeles?

For a standard residential event with 10-15 guests, expect $70-85 per person for complete service. This includes professional chef, all food (proteins, fried rice, vegetables, sauces), equipment, setup, performance, and cleanup. Larger events (30+ guests) often see per-person costs drop to $60-70 range due to economies of scale. Small intimate gatherings (under 10 people) may have slightly higher per-person rates or a minimum spend requirement. Custom menus with premium upgrades (all-filet, lobster tail) run higher. Is hibachi catering actually cheaper than going to a restaurant in LA?

The math is closer than people think. Quality teppanyaki restaurants in LA charge $40-60 per person for the meal alone. Add 9.5% sales tax, 18-20% tip, $15-20 parking, and beverages (restaurants mark up drinks heavily), and you're easily at $70-85 per person anyway. Plus you coordinated everyone across LA traffic, dealt with reservation hassles, and spent 3+ hours including travel. With catering, everyone's already at your location, parking is free, drinks are BYOB at your cost, and the per-person rate includes everything. For groups of 12+, catering almost always wins on total cost and definitely wins on convenience and experience quality.
